From Breakfast with Buddha by Roland Merullo. My expansion on the idea: "I wondered what my own religion might be. If I had defined it that way, that broadly, as the primary focus of my thourhts and passions, what would it be?"
My religion would embrace love and acceptance.
It would ask that one not judge others.
It would ask us to forgive others who we feel have wronged us.
It would ask us to seek forgiveness from others whom we may have wronged.
It would be a religion of being kind to oneself and to others.
It would ask one to actively work in whatever way one could at helping the world to be a better place.
It would ask the follower, if at all possible and in any small or large way, to help others in need and minimally to acknowledge the need not ignore it.
The religion would not need to take place in a special place or with a group of people but if that felt right, it could.
There would be no expense to run the religion and therefore would not take any fundraising or have any financial needs.
Everyone could be part of the religion whatever their financial, socio economic, or educational, racial, or sexual identification background.
It would include sharing the meal table with others as often as possible.
